Troubleshooting Common Health App Issues: What to Do When Pure Data Sabotages Your Goals

Health apps have revolutionized how we manage fitness, nutrition, mental health, and chronic conditions. Yet, even the most sophisticated digital health tools sometimes fail us — silent alarms don't sound, syncing glitches throw off data, and confusing app interfaces frustrate users. When technology seems to sabotage rather than support your health goals, understanding how to troubleshoot can empower you to regain control and optimize your digital wellness experience.

Understanding the Common Health App Challenges

Before diving into solutions, it helps to know the typical issues health app users face. These problems often fall into a few categories:

Silent Alarms and Notification Failures

Many health apps rely on notifications to remind users to take medication, log meals, or complete workouts. When alarms fail silently, critical health behaviors may be missed, undermining progress.

App Syncing Issues Across Devices

Synchronization between smartphones, wearables, and cloud servers is vital to keeping your health data accurate and up-to-date. Sync errors can lead to conflicting information or missing entries.

User Interface Confusion and Data Overload

Complex interfaces or data dumps can overwhelm users, making it hard to find actionable insights or navigate features effectively. This can dampen motivation.

Recognizing these pain points is the first step to mastering technology management for your wellbeing.

Diagnosing and Fixing Silent Alarm Problems

Check System-Level Notification Settings

Your phone’s global notification settings often override app-level alarms. On both iOS and Android, ensure the health app has permission to send alerts with sound and vibrations enabled.

Update Apps and Operating Systems

Developers regularly fix bugs causing alarm failures in app updates. Also, outdated mobile OS software may hamper notifications. Keeping both current is critical.

Use Third-Party Reminder Tools as Backup

If persistent silent alarms are an issue, integrate your health reminders with native calendar apps or smart assistants like Siri or Google Assistant for redundancy.

Tackling App Syncing Issues Effectively

Confirm Stable Internet and Bluetooth Connections

Most syncing requires internet and often Bluetooth for wearables. Weak signals or intermittent connections cause sync failures or partial updates.

Force a Manual Sync and Restart Devices

Many health apps have manual sync options; try these if automatic sync stalls. Restart your smartphone, wearable, and any intermediate hubs to reset connections.

Check for Account or Password Conflicts

Syncing typically requires cloud accounts. Errors like incorrect login credentials or permission revocations can interrupt data flow. Re-authenticate accounts as required.

Overcoming User Interface Frustrations

Customize Dashboards and Alerts to Your Needs

Health apps with customizable dashboards let you prioritize what matters most—be it medication, hydration, or activity steps—reducing data overload.

Leverage Tutorials and Support Resources

Many developers offer user guides, video walkthroughs, and FAQs. Spending time upfront understanding features saves future frustration.

Engage with User Communities and Forums

Online communities provide peer advice for resolving subtle UX problems and creative hacks to improve app workflows. Sites like Reddit often have dedicated health app groups.

Maintaining Motivation When Technology Stumbles

Set Realistic Expectations for Digital Health Tools

Apps help but don’t replace consistent lifestyle habits. Acknowledge that technical glitches happen and keep focus on progress, not perfection.

Use Backup Manual Methods Temporarily

When tech fails, using paper logs or alarm clocks temporarily can maintain accountability. This ensures momentum isn’t lost when waiting for app fixes.

Celebrate Small Wins to Build Empowerment

Recognize even modest achievements to reinforce positive behavior. This keeps engagement high even during technical setbacks.

Best Practices to Prevent Health App Issues

Regularly Update Apps and Devices

Maintain the latest software versions to benefit from bug fixes, security patches, and feature improvements.

Monitor Battery and Memory Usage

Low battery or insufficient storage hampers app performance and syncing. Keep devices charged and clear unwanted files.

Review App Permissions and Data Privacy Settings

Ensure apps have the right permissions for full functionality but remain vigilant about privacy to protect sensitive health data.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Why do my health app alarms sometimes not go off?

Silent alarms often result from disabled notifications at the device level, battery saving settings limiting background activity, or app bugs. Check permissions and keep apps updated.

How can I fix continuous syncing failures between phone and wearable?

Try restarting devices, checking Bluetooth and Wi-Fi strength, forcing manual syncs, and logging out/in of the application. Also, verify that accounts are correctly authorized.

What should I do if the health app interface feels too complicated?

Customize dashboards to show only essential data, consult official tutorials, or seek peer advice via community forums. Simpler apps might be an alternative if needed.

Are there ways to back up my health data independently?

Many apps offer exporting data to CSV or connecting with third-party platforms. Regular backups to cloud storage or local files help prevent data loss.

How can I protect my privacy while using health apps?

Review app privacy policies, adjust permission settings, avoid unnecessary data sharing, and use apps with strong encryption and transparent data handling practices.
